Applicable Modifiers
Specific codes or signals used in medical billing to indicate that a service or item has been altered in some way without changing the definition.
Surgical Code
A surgical code is a unique identifier used in healthcare billing and record-keeping to denote specific surgical procedures performed.
CPT Manual
A publication by the American Medical Association that provides codes for billing medical procedures and services.
HCPCS Level
Healthcare Common Procedure Coding System, a set of codes used for billing and coding medical procedures and equipment in the United States.
